Hi
please i need your help when i try to Restore mailbox Exchange 2010 useing Backup exec 2012
if mailbox content this [] characters in the display name give follwing error
The job failed with the following error: Cannot restore one or more mailboxes. The database that the mailboxes reside in is dismounted or is not accessible. Ensure that the server is available and that the database is mounted, and then run the job again
V-79-57344-764

I think you are going to have to log a formal support case for us to look into this more throughly as it looks like it has not been reported to us against BE 2012.
If you do log a formal support case then please quote "ETRACK 2821172" which seems to be similar and was apparently found by QA enginers working on the next BE version. Quoting this reference will hopefully speed up the handling of your case.
BTW AFAIK the reason we have problems with this is that the [ and ] characters are actually used to show mailbox name and display name in the restore selections - as such you customizing your accounts to use [ and ] then has a conflict.

Try to redirect the mailbox to a .pst file or another mailbox whose display name does not have special characters. Here is how to redirect.
